Minor Details: Games of May 11

Strong starting pitching throughout.

COLUMBUS 6, ST. PAUL 5 IN COLUMBUS (12 INNINGS)

It was deja vu all over again, as Alex Call again drove home the deciding run in the twelfth inning.

Curtis Terry was 3-for-5 with a double.
Cole Sturgeon was 2-for-5 with two doubles.
Caleb Hamilton was 1-for-3 with two walks.

Chi Chi Gonzalez struck out seven in six hitless, scoreless innings, giving up four walks.
Ian Hamilton struck out three in 1.1 scoreless innings, giving up a hit and a walk.

The Saints are 15-15, tied for sixth place in the International League West with Indianapolis and Memphis, 5.5 games behind Nashville.

WICHITA 4, NORTHWEST ARKANSAS 3 IN NORTHWEST ARKANSAS

The Wind Surge led 4-1 going to the bottom of the ninth and held on.

Austin Martin was 2-for-5 with a triple.
Leobaldo Cabrera was 1-for-2 with a two-run homer.

Matt Canterino struck out six in four shutout innings, giving up two hits and no walks.
Kody Funderburk pitched two shutout innings, giving up two hits and two walks and striking out one.

The Wind Surge is 17-11, tied for first place in the Texas League North with Tulsa.

CEDAR RAPIDS 7, PEORIA 1 IN PEORIA

Christian Encarnacion-Strand was 3-for-4 with a triple, a walk, and two runs.
Jeferson Morales was 1-for-3 with a grand slam (his second homer), two walks, and two runs.
Alerick Soularie was 1-for-3 with two walks.

Sean Mooney pitched five innings, giving up an unearned run on four hits and no walks and striking out four.
Cody Laweryson pitched three perfect innings, striking out two.
Melvi Acosta pitched a scoreless inning, giving up two hits.

The Kernels are 21-8, in first place in the Midwest League West, two games ahead of Wisconsin.

FORT MYERS 3, PALM BEACH 0 IN FORT MYERS

Kyler Fedco was 2-for-3 with a double and a walk.
Jake Rucker was 2-for-4.

Travis Adams struck out six in five shutout innings, giving up two hits and two walks.
Malik Barrington struck out five in two shutout innings, giving up a walk.
Regi Grace pitched a perfect inning, striking out one.
Matthew Swain struck out two in a scoreless inning, giving up one hit.

The Mighty Mussels are 16-10, in first place in the Florida State League West, two games ahead of Bradenton.
